    I've always called the shipper to let them know that the snake arrived fine, or that I've picked it up from FedEx when I've asked to have it held at FedEx for pick-up on days I can't get off work (FedEx is 2 miles from my house).

    I can't receive shipments at work, so it's either take the day off, or have held for pick-up at FedEx (which is nice when it's really hot or really cold, because they are in a climate controlled facility all day).

    I understand how you feel. It is hard to wonder what happened to your baby after it leaves your hands. Especially when you KNOW it should have been delivered by x. I usually tell those who buy from me. "I offer a live arrival garentee, so it is very important to le me know all is ok when you get them. If I have not heard from you 3 hours after you get the package then the live arrival garentee is void." I try not to be pissy about it but I feel if the person getting my baby isn't willing to work with me then my hands are tied.
